Reviewer 1 Report

Dear Authors,

Thank you for interesting paper. After reading the presented manuscript, I have some questions and suggestion as below.

1. Why the as-prepared samples were immersed in 1% HNO3 solution? What was the aim of this process?

2. Was the electrolyte bath stirred during deposition process?

3. Line 74 - the word "electronic" and "Quantan" should be corrrected to the form "electron" and "Quanta", respectively.

4. The Scherer equation to calculate of average grain size should be provided.

5. Line 86/87 - What does the "30d, 60d, 120d" mean? Probably, you mean about time (in second) of immersion. Please, correct it.

6. The designation markings of equation number 1 and 2 are not explained. Please, add it.

7. How did you measured the Vickers hardness? The thickness of deposited coating was relatively thin with respect to the applied indenter. Are you sure that obtained results relate to the zinc coating and not the substrate?

8. Did you analysed the bright particles on the surface of deposited coatings (especially visible in figure 5c)? What are that?

The microstructure observations should be extended to the cross-section of deposited coating.

Reviewer 2 Report

Comments to the author:

This manuscript reports on showing the significant effect of pulse frequency during applying the electrodeposition method on grain orientation of the final coating.

There are quite a few works needed overall on building the motivation in the introduction and application in the conclusion. There are concerns with the presentation of data in the figures, and the explanation of data is not thorough.

 

1. The abstract should contain the best data from the paper. Specific data has to be included in the abstract. The significance of the study also needs to be mentioned in the abstract.

 

2. Writing of the overall context needs to be improved and smoothed for flow.

 

3. More details about the SEM and XRD parameters need to be supplemented in section 2.2.

 

4. When reporting on animal or human experiments, a statement that ethical approval from the national or local authorities was obtained should be added to the main text of your manuscript, including the assigned approval/accreditation number.

 

5. Page 4, line 119: please add statistical analysis for comparing the coating thickness under different conditions.

 

6. Page 5, line 140. Reference needs to be added here: To explore the preferred orientation of electrodeposited zinc deposit, the texture co-139 efficient was calculated according to Muresan’s method.

 

7. Page 5, lines 146-149: Why did there happen to be a drop in the Tc value of the (11.0) plane compared to the (10.0) plane in the 1000 Hz group?

 

 

8. Page 6, line 175: please check the figure caption of Figure 5.
